A homely place with good prices and really nice staff. Ended up staying half an hour after closing time on accident but the staff were very happy to have us, will go there often.

I don't know the area, in fact I've never been to Hendon in my life. I was in the area as I had to meet someone on business at the Middlesex University. I was about 30mins early so thought if grab a quick bite. I was walking up the steep road past you're usual fast food and chicken joints (nothing wrong with that, I am partial to the odd burger), then suddenly I stumbled on this place. It's quite cool, reminds me of a quirky dining room. Decor was interesting, the place has an intimate feel and staff were nice. The menu is pretty standard, but that's no bad thing. Simple things done well, beats these extravagant menus that offer drivel. Theres a fair few healthy options as well... I'm not sure when im next going to Hendon..but I'll check it out if ever I'm in the data
